Description
Map of Kentucky and Tennessee exhibiting the post offices, post roads, canals, railroads, etc. by David H. Burr. This map of Kentucky and Tennessee exhibiting the post offices, post roads, canals, railroads, shows relief by hachures, drainage, township and county boundaries, cities and towns. A key indicates the different road types. David H. Burr acted as official topographer of the US Postal Service from 1832 until 1838 at which time he was appointed official geographer of the US House of Representatives until 1847.
